Beyond malware and legal issues, patched software often exhibits unpredictable behavior. Modifications may introduce new bugs, cause conflicts with other software, or lead to system instability. Additionally, patched versions typically cannot receive official updates or security patches, leaving them vulnerable to known exploits – a scenario described as "exploitation of vulnerabilities for which patches already exist".
